Introduction To Role
In this pivotal role, you will design, implement, and optimize robust cloud-based infrastructure and operational frameworks that enable rapid innovation and deliver exceptional system reliability. You will also guide and mentor team members, sharing your expertise in AWS CDK automation, Kubernetes, networking, and DevOps standard processes. Accountabilities Infrastructure Design & Management: Architect and manage scalable, multi-tenant AWS based infrastructure using AWS CDK, ensuring modular and maintainable codebases. Kubernetes & EKS: Lead the deployment and management of Kubernetes clusters using Amazon EKS, implementing standard processes for scalability and security. CI/CD Pipelines: Build, manage, and enhance automated CI/CD pipelines to ensure efficient, reliable deployments using tools like ArgoCD and GitHub Actions. IAM Role Management: Design, maintain, and optimize IAM roles, policies, and guardrails to ensure least privilege access across AWS resources. Networking: Architect and maintain AWS networking components such as VPCs, Transit Gateway, ALB, and Security Groups, ensuring robust security and performance. Security & Compliance: Implement DevSecOps standard processes, including IAM security, encryption standards, and compliance with industry regulations (GXP, GDPR, HIPAA, NIST). AWS WAF & Firewall Policies: Design and implement firewall policies and AWS WAF configurations to protect applications from web threats. Automation: Lead efforts to automate infrastructure provisioning, application releases, and ETL workflows, reducing manual intervention and improving efficiency. Monitoring & Incident Response: Develop and implement comprehensive monitoring, logging, and alerting systems using OpenTelemetry, Prometheus, Grafana, AWS CloudWatch, and AWS CloudTrail.
